In Australia, the Deodorization Systems market is witnessing significant growth, driven by the need for odor control solutions across various industries such as wastewater treatment, food processing, and industrial manufacturing. Deodorization systems are crucial for eliminating unpleasant odors and maintaining air quality standards in indoor and outdoor environments. Factors such as urbanization, industrialization, and stringent environmental regulations are fueling the demand for effective odor control technologies. Market players are focusing on developing advanced deodorization systems capable of handling diverse odor sources and operating efficiently in different settings.
The Australia Deodorization Systems market is primarily driven by the need for odor control and air purification across various industries. Industries such as wastewater treatment plants, food processing, and waste management facilities require effective deodorization systems to comply with environmental regulations and maintain a healthy working environment. Additionally, the growing concern for air quality and public health has heightened the demand for deodorization solutions in commercial and residential settings. Moreover, technological advancements in deodorization systems, such as ozone generators and activated carbon filters, have improved efficiency and expanded market opportunities in Australia.
In the Australia Deodorization Systems market, one of the primary challenges is the high initial investment required for installing and maintaining deodorization systems. These systems are essential for eliminating unpleasant odors in various industrial and municipal applications, but their installation and operational costs can be significant. Additionally, technological advancements and evolving environmental regulations necessitate continuous upgrades and modifications to deodorization systems, adding to the overall cost burden. Moreover, the complexity of odor control in diverse environments, such as wastewater treatment plants and industrial facilities, poses technical challenges for system design and implementation.
Government policies and regulations related to environmental protection and air quality management significantly influence the Australia Deodorization Systems market. Regulatory bodies such as the Australia Department of Environment and Energy establish standards and guidelines for controlling odors and emissions from industrial facilities, wastewater treatment plants, and agricultural operations. Compliance with air quality regulations may require the installation of deodorization systems to mitigate odor emissions and protect public health and the environment. Government incentives or subsidies for implementing odor control technologies or adopting sustainable practices could also impact market dynamics by encouraging investment in advanced deodorization solutions.
